You can program your new key fob using an existing spare key fob. First make sure you lock the driver's door and close all the other doors. Then you can press the unlock button on your spare key fob 5 times with approximately 2 seconds between each. This will cause the car's horn sound honk and will begin the process of programming. After 6 seconds, remove your spare key and switch off the ignition to finish the program.

The majority of modern VW cars have a high-tech anti-theft system known as an immobiliser, which is designed to stop the engine from beginning if the wrong key is used. To do this, the ignition key has a microchip inside it which responds to an a specific signal generated by the vehicle's computer. If the chip does not get the right response the engine won't begin, and it might even shut down immediately.
